Israeli Dual Citizens Permitted to Travel with Foreign Passports Through December

In the post-Corona era, it has been extremely difficult for Israeli citizens to obtain or renew passports. This is particularly true for Israelis residing abroad who must apply for passports at their local Israeli embassies or consulates. Both in Israel and abroad, the wait time for passport appointments can often be as long as half a year.

As reported by Chaim V’Chessed, Israeli citizens who also hold another citizenship are currently allowed to travel utilizing their foreign passports when entering or leaving Israel. This rule was set to expire on June 30, 2023.

We are now pleased to share that this allowance has now been extended until December 31, 2023. This will enable overseas travel for Israelis with dual citizenship, even if they cannot renew their Israeli passports.
